Sono
del tutto simili alle "Maschere di visualizzazione",
i "Reports" vengono però usati per rappresentare
graficamente i dati che verranno stampati.
Access 97, consente di salvare una Maschera direttamente
come un Reports, in questo modo mi ritrovo la
stampa del form che ho creato per la visualizzazione
video.
Esiste
ovvimanente una certa differenza tra una Maschera
e un Report, la maschera contiene pulsanti e comandi
interattivi, i reports necessitano impostazioni
particolari quali dimensione di pagina, subtotali,
intestazioni....
Proprio per questo motivo è sconsigliabile salvare
una maschera come un report.
Lo
studio del layout del report è un punto piuttosto
importante di tutta la progettazione di un software,
la stampa finale è il risultato ultimo e più diretto
all'utente di tutto il programma. Una stesura
chiara e ordinata dei dati (anche in termini di
colori e immagini) permette d'avere una visione
immediata e semplice di tutto il lavoro svolto.
Nei
Reports esiste una funzione che permette di contare
le righe in stampa in una tabella (da impostare
nelle proprietà in un campo).
Una funzione, questa, molto utile nella pratica,
che sfortunatamente non è presente nelle Maschere.
Una
considerazione riguardo ai Reports è d'obbligo,
i margini e tutte le impostazioni di pagina sono
funzioni del tipo di stampante selezionata.
Questo significa che cambiando stampante, il risultato
finale potrebbe leggermente differire dal risultato
ottenuto con un'altra stampante, per ovviare a
questo inconveniente è sempre consigliabile impostare
margini non eccessivamente ridotti e non inserire
campi nelle prossimità dei margini stessi.
Un
report può essere aperto sia in modalità "anteprima
di stampa" (preview) che in modalità "normale",
cioè stampato direttamente.
Se distribuiamo un'applicazione che apre report
in anteprima di stampa, assicuriamoci sempre di
aver abilitato la visualizzazione della rispettiva
icona di stampa, altrimenti non
sarà possibile lanciare la stampa.